C#属性,字段怎么理解,字段我只知道是数据库表里有字段,这里的字段不一样的吧

2025-03-01 03:08:13
推荐回答(3个)
回答1:

当然不同了,c#中属性有get{}读取器和set书写器和有方法的特性,可以加入逻辑,字段的使用比较单纯一点,灵活使用属性对于设计类使用类都是基础而重要的技能

回答2:

一般情况下应该是相同的,在数据库专业的语言中,关系里的列一般习惯上称为某属性,而在一些数据库开发软件中象VF中表中列一般称为字段。本质是相同的只是称呼不同

回答3:

C#中的属性类似于方法(或称为函数),其实就是C++中的Get和Set方法了,
你可以定制只读,只写,或可读写三种模式,与数据库表里的字段不是一个意思